Quick Assessment

This informative book introduces readers ages 9-12 to the fascinating systems of the human body through clear, accessible text supported by full-color photos and diagrams. It covers topics like digestion, blood functions, and other physiological processes, aligned with educational standards. Suitable for middle-grade readers, it offers a gentle and educational exploration of human biology without intense or distressing content.
